What they do

A Leasing Consultant works within the rental office of an apartment complex or residential community. Responsible for sales and marketing of rental properties and dealing with maintenance requests and customer service needs of existing tenants.

In supporting Cambridge Management Services, Inc.'s commitment to excellent customer service and a high quality living environment The Leasing Consultant, under the supervision of the Property Manager is responsible for leasing and pre-leasing apartments and implementing the community's marketing plan. The consultant will also review applications, prepare lease paperwork, review the lease of existing residents and assist in coordinating resident activities.

The Leasing Consultant is the property's sales representative whose primary duties are to greet prospects, to present the features and benefits of their property. Properly secure lease agreements from qualified persons. The Leasing Consultant is very service oriented and strives to make the current residents feel welcome and comfortable in their community.
